Udemy, Inc. (NASDAQ:UDMY – Get Free Report) has been given a consensus recommendation of “Moderate Buy” by the twelve research firms that are covering the firm, MarketBeat.com reports.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, three have given a hold rating and eight have issued a buy rating on the company. The average 12-month price target among analysts that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$10.95.
Several research firms have commented on UDMY. Scotiabank began coverage on Udemy in a research note on Thursday, December 5th. They set a “sector outperform” rating and a $10.00 price objective for the company. Canaccord Genuity Group boosted their price objective on Udemy from $12.00 to $14.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Friday, February 14th. Needham & Company LLC restated a “buy” rating and set a $11.00 target price on shares of Udemy in a report on Wednesday. Morgan Stanley boosted their target price on Udemy from $7.50 to $9.00 and gave the stock an “underweight” rating in a report on Thursday, February 20th. Finally, William Blair cut Udemy from an “outperform” rating to a “market perform” rating in a report on Wednesday.

Udemy Trading Down 1.5 %
Udemy (NASDAQ:UDMY –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 13th. The company reported ($0.03) E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.07 by ($0.10). Udemy had a negative return on equity of 27.93% and a negative net margin of 10.84%. The firm had revenue of $199.94 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$194.70 million. On average, research analysts forecast that Udemy will post -0.09 earnings per share for the current year.
Insider Activity at Udemy
In related news, Director Heather Hiles sold 14,840 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, February 19th. The stock was sold at an average price of $9.81, for a total value of $145,580.40. Following the transaction, the director now directly owns 42,667 shares in the company, valued at approximately $418,563.27. This represents a 25.81 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. Udemy Company Profile
Udemy, Inc, a learning company, that operates a marketplace platform for learning skills in the United States and internationally. The company offers skill acquisition, development, and validation courses for organizations and individuals, through direct-to-consumer or Udemy Business offerings in various languages.
